Summary
A man who cannot be named for legal reasons had sentences for breaching protection and safety orders reconsidered on appeal. The District Court Appeals Court affirmed his three-month suspended sentence for the protection-order breach and increased a one-month sentence for the safety-order breach to three months, suspending it in full for 18 months. The court imposed conditions including completion of the MOVE course, civil contact with his ex-partner and compliance with court orders.
